The Context of the Event

In a heartbreaking event just before the kickoff of the World Cup, an aid worker in Gaza was tragically killed by an Israeli airstrike. This individual was instrumental in organizing screenings for the tournament, which had become a rare source of joy and unity for civilians amid relentless conflict. The worker's efforts were aimed at providing a momentary escape for the people of Gaza, who have faced ongoing hardships due to the violence and instability in the region.

Impact on the Community

The murder of this aid worker has sent shockwaves throughout Gaza. Locals had looked forward to the World Cup screenings as a way to momentarily forget the dire circumstances surrounding them. For many, the screening events represented hope and a chance to bond over a common love for football. The airstrike not only extinguished a life but also quashed the community's spirit during a time of celebration.

The Role of Sports in Conflict Zones

Sports have long been recognized as a unifying force, particularly in conflict zones. Events such as the World Cup provide an opportunity for individuals to gather, celebrate, and share in communal experiences. In Gaza, these screenings were more than just football games—they were lifelines that connected people, fostering a sense of normalcy amidst chaos. The loss of the aid worker underlines the fragility of such moments and the dire consequences of ongoing conflict.
